The 3 months correlation between Interactive and Envestnet is 0.59.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Interactive Brokers Group and Envestnet in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Envestnet and Interactive Brokers is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Interactive Brokers Group are associated (or correlated) with Envestnet.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Envestnet has no effect on the direction of Interactive Brokers i.e., Interactive Brokers and Envestnet go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Interactive Brokers and Envestnet

The main advantage of trading using opposite Interactive Brokers and Envestnet posit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Interactive Brokers position performs unexpectedly, Envestnet can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Envestnet will offset losses from the drop in Envestnet's long position.
The idea behind Interactive Brokers Group and Envestnet p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
